Enhancing Space Efficiency

Utilizing Vertical Space to its Fullest Potential


One of the most significant advantages of vertical grow systems is their ability to make the most of limited space. Agriculture often faces the challenge of accommodating plants in small areas, especially in urban settings where land comes at a premium. By utilizing vertical space, cultivators can stack plants to increase their overall capacity, enabling them to grow a larger quantity of cannabis.


Vertical grow systems can be designed with multiple tiers or shelves, allowing cultivators to expand their production vertically. This vertical expansion can be done using racks, shelves, or specially designed structures, enabling growers to stack plants while still providing sufficient light and air circulation to each level. This space-efficient approach is not only practical but also cost-effective, ensuring a higher return on investment for indoor cannabis farming.


Optimal Light Distribution

Ensuring Uniform Light Exposure for Maximum Growth


Light is crucial for the growth and development of cannabis plants. Vertical grow systems are specifically designed to provide uniform light exposure, addressing the common issue of uneven lighting in traditional horizontal setups. With vertical arrangements, each level within the system receives equal light from top to bottom, ensuring consistent growth throughout the crop.


Adequate light distribution is achieved through the strategic placement of grow lights, often using LED technology. These lights can be positioned at regular intervals to cover the entire vertical space within the grow system. This arrangement ensures that every plant receives the same amount of light, reducing the risk of uneven growth and increasing overall crop quality and yield.


Enhanced Air Circulation

Efficient Ventilation Systems for Optimal Airflow


Proper air circulation is essential for maintaining a healthy and productive cannabis crop. Vertical grow systems incorporate advanced ventilation systems that ensure efficient airflow throughout the entire setup. By eliminating stagnant air pockets and reducing humidity, these systems mitigate the risk of mold, mildew, and pest infestations.


The vertical arrangement of plants allows airflow to pass between the tiers easily. Ventilation systems are strategically positioned to facilitate air movement and prevent hotspots or cold spots within the grow area. This optimal airflow not only reduces the likelihood of plant diseases but also improves overall plant transpiration, nutrient uptake, and CO2 absorption, resulting in healthier and more robust cannabis plants.

Enhanced Pest and Disease Control

Minimizing Crop Losses through Controlled Environments


Indoor cannabis farming is particularly prone to pest infestations and diseases due to the controlled environment and close proximity of plants. However, vertical grow systems offer better control over these potential issues. With a vertical arrangement, growers can quickly identify, isolate, and address any pest or disease outbreaks, minimizing the risk of crop losses.


Additionally, vertical grow systems often include features such as automated climate control and integrated pest management systems. These advanced technologies continuously monitor and adjust temperature, humidity, and moisture levels, creating an environment that discourages pests and diseases from proliferating. By maintaining a healthier and pest-free crop, cultivators can harvest high-quality cannabis consistently.
